Well, having given Thomas Friedman's pro-globalisation
"The Lexus and the Olive Tree" a perusal, I thought I had to
give the opposing view, Naomi Klein's celebrated anti-globalisation/anti-corporation
tome, "No Logo", a try. And the verdict: I'm really enjoying
it, although I find some of her arguments a bit wobbly. But whether you
agree with Klein or not, in this day of violent protests at every World
Economic Forum and the curious rise in the jostling of politicians as
they campaign, I think the modern citizen is ill-prepared to deal with
the modern world if they haven't read this work. The (true) anecdotes
in the book are just great: how the Tommy Hilfiger company actually produces
nothing, it just licences its name; or Pepsi's "threat" to project
its logo onto the face of the moon! Worth a look if you're after some
interesting non-fiction.

A NEW KIND OF MOVIEMAKING As most people who know me will tell you, I love movies, and in the near future, I intend to make one. Which is what brought me to the SMPTE Exhibition here in Sydney last Friday (it's an exhibition for TV and film equipment companies to show off their wares). Of particular interest to me was the Sony exhibit and seeing Sony's new 24P High Definition Digital Video camera -- otherwise known as the digital video camera that George Lucas used to shoot Episode II. Since this technology pretty much harks the end of the use of 35mm film (George Lucas has said that he "won't go back" and James Cameron has stated that his next movie will also be shot on digital video), I figured it was worth a look. In a word, it was awesome. And look at it this way: Lucas spent $100,000 on video tape shooting Episode II. If he had used (the notoriously expensive) 35mm film, it would have cost him $1.8 million...just for the film! I have seen the future and it is digital... 3. SOMETHING POLITICAL IS IN THE AIR...
